About Us
In 1977, a small group of people in the Illawarra area banded together to help animals in distress and thus laid the foundations for the Illawarra Branch of AWL NSW as it is today. Many years have passed, but our mission has remained the same: to achieve a reasonable quality of life for all animals by giving practical assistance to them and their owners when needed.
Our Branch receives thousands of requests each year to help solve many and varied animal problems, not only from the general public, but also from community groups, local councils, hospitals, schools, commercial businesses, heavy industry, and the police. Through discussion, counselling, co-operation and financial assistance, we work to achieve positive outcomes, with the animal’s best interests always being our foremost priority.
